People leave cell phones in cars all of the time and they have lithium batteries also. I haven't heard of any of them blowing up but the life expectancy will suffer.
Here is info for you:
"Lithium batteries like heat, but not too much. In the winter time, try to keep your batteries from the cold as much as possible. Leave them in the car while your flying, or keep them in your cargo pants... etc. At the same time don't let them heat up too much. Try to keep your batteries from reaching 160F after use. This will prolong the life of the cells."
